Verstappen gets 25,000 for skipping media duties
Red Bull driver Max Verstappen has been hit with a 25,000 fine for failing to attend the mandatory driver interview, in the media pen at Baku, after he retired from the Azerbaijan Grand Prix. The teenage Dutchman was fuming after his fourth retirement due to technical issues while his teammate Daniel Ricciardo survived the mayhem to post the team's first win. A fact hardly consoled Verstappen who had the better of his Aussie teammate all weekend and would no doubt have felt that bar 'a sudden failure in the engine' he would have been standing on the top step of the podium.
